Job Title: Physical Therapist Degree

Health Careers in Saskatchewan is seeking a highly skilled Physical Therapist Degree to join our team at the Yorkton Regional Health Centre.

Job Summary

The successful candidate will be responsible for providing physical therapy services to clients at the Yorkton Regional Health Centre, as well as providing coverage in other service areas in staff absences. The Physical Therapist Degree will be accountable for assisting in planning, organizing, and performing within the Physical Therapy Professional Guidelines to ensure that clients/residents referred receive a high standard of physical therapy.

Key Responsibilities
  • Provide physical therapy services to clients at the Yorkton Regional Health Centre
  • Provide coverage in other service areas in staff absences
  • Assist in planning, organizing, and performing within the Physical Therapy Professional Guidelines
  • Ensure that clients/residents referred receive a high standard of physical therapy
Requirements
  • Bachelor of Science in Physical Therapy
  • Registered Physical Therapist (PT)
  • Valid Class 5 driver's license
  • Ability to recognize and maintain confidential information
  • Must demonstrate safety as a priority at all times
Preferred Qualifications
  • Travel within the region and provincially
  • Registered/eligible with the Saskatchewan College of Physical Therapists (SCPT)
  • Preference to HSAS members as per the SAHO/HSAS Collective Agreement
